... Read moreAs someone with acne-prone skin, I completely understand the struggle of wanting to enjoy a beautiful beach day without worrying about breakouts or sensitivity. Over time, I’ve refined my 'rise-n-shine' skincare routine, especially my skin prep for sunny outings, and I've found a few key steps that truly make a difference. My morning GRWM (Get Ready With Me) for the beach always starts with gentle cleansing. Then comes my secret weapon: Anua Azelaic Acid serum. For those wondering, 'does Anua Azelaic Acid help for sunburn?' it’s important to clarify that it’s not a substitute for SPF, but I've personally found it to be a fantastic supportive player in my routine. Azelaic acid is known for its anti-inflammatory properties, which can help calm redness and irritation. While it won't prevent a sunburn, I feel like it aids in soothing my skin if it's been exposed to the sun's harsh rays, and also helps prevent post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ation that sun exposure can sometimes trigger, especially on blemish-prone complexions. It's become a crucial element in my post-sun care strategy, focusing on recovery and maintaining an even skin tone. For my fellow friends with acne-prone skin, the Anua Azelaic Acid has been a game-changer. It diligently works to reduce inflammation, unclog pores, and tackle those stubborn breakouts without leaving my skin feeling stripped or irritated. I apply a thin layer after my toner, letting it fully absorb before moving on to the next steps. It creates a smoother canvas, which is essential when you want your skin to look its best, even under the unforgiving beach light. After the azelaic acid, I layer on a lightweight, hydrating serum, followed by a non-comedogenic moisturizer. The most critical of my tips for skin prep for the beach, however, is undoubtedly sunscreen. I always opt for a broad-spectrum, water-resistant SPF 50+ and apply a generous amount, ensuring every inch of exposed skin is covered. Reapplication every two hours, or immediately after swimming or excessive sweating, is non-negotiable for me. I also pack a wide-brimmed hat and sunglasses, and try to spend peak sun hours under an umbrella or in the shade. These layers of protection are vital not just for preventing painful sunburn, but also for keeping my acne-prone skin happy and healthy. Beyond topical products, staying h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day is key, and a refreshing facial mist can offer instant relief on a hot day. When packing my beach bag, my Anua Azelaic Acid often makes the cut for my evening routine too, ready to help calm any potential irritation after a fun day in the sun. It's all about a proactive and gentle approach to skincare, ensuring I can fully enjoy the beach without stressing about my skin.
